Energy Efficiency Scores
When picking an air conditioning device for your home, consider the energy efficiency rankings to assure economical cooling. Power efficiency is very important for conserving money on your energy expenses while also lowering your environmental impact. The Seasonal Power Performance Proportion (SEER) is a key metric to take notice of when evaluating ac unit. Greater SEER scores suggest much better power effectiveness and capacity for cost financial savings in the future. By selecting an unit with a high SEER score, you can appreciate reduced energy intake and lowered cooling costs in time.
It is essential to distinguish between Energy Performance Proportion (EER) and SEER when assessing the performance of an air conditioning unit. While EER represents the cooling result of the system split by the electric input under details problems, SEER gives a typical efficiency over a whole air conditioning period. Understanding the difference between these two ratings can aid you make a notified decision when choosing an energy-efficient ac system for your home. Focusing on SEER rankings can lead to significant energy cost savings and enhanced cooling efficiency.
Size and Cooling Ability
To make certain optimal efficiency and efficiency in your air conditioning unit, comprehending the proper dimension and cooling ability for your home is important. Appropriate sizing is essential for making sure that your a/c unit can properly cool your room without unneeded power consumption. A cooling device that's also tiny will certainly struggle to cool your home adequately, bring about boosted energy costs and lowered cooling down performance. On the other hand, a large unit may cool down the air quickly however won't appropriately evaporate the area, leading to a clammy setting.
When determining the right dimension for your a/c device, variables such as the square video footage of your home, ceiling height, insulation degrees, and regional climate must be thought about. Consulting with a specialist heating and cooling technician can aid you precisely compute the cooling capacity required for your details requirements. By selecting the correct dimension for your cooling unit, you can maximize cooling down efficiency, power effectiveness, and overall convenience in your home.
Sorts Of Cooling Equipments
Selecting the best cooling system for your home is crucial for preserving a comfy indoor atmosphere. When considering different types of air conditioning systems, two preferred options you might come across are ductless mini divides and window units.
Ductless mini divides are flexible systems that include an exterior compressor unit and one or more interior air-handling units. They're efficient, offer zoned cooling, and are quieter contrasted to standard central air conditioning systems. Ductless mini divides are a wonderful option for homes without existing ductwork or for room additions.
On the various other hand, window systems are an even more typical and mobile option. These units are self-contained, with all parts housed in a solitary box that's mounted in a window or a specially designed wall surface opening. Window units are affordable, simple to set up, and suitable for cooling individual spaces. However, they might be much less energy-efficient than ductless mini divides and can obstruct natural light and views.

Think about the format and cooling down requirements of your home to determine which kind of cooling system is the best fit for you.
Consider Your Home's Format
When evaluating your design, 2 crucial aspects to keep in mind are ductwork choices and zoning factors to consider.
To start with, examine the ductwork alternatives in your house. If your house currently has ductwork in position, a central air conditioning system might be a convenient and economical selection. This system makes use of a network of air ducts to disperse amazing air throughout your home effectively. On the other hand, if your home does not have ductwork, a ductless mini-split system can be a viable option. These systems are much easier to install in homes without existing air ducts and use flexibility in cooling down various zones of your house independently.
Next off, take into consideration zoning considerations. Zoning enables you to separate your home into different locations with different temperature level controls. This can be helpful if particular areas of your home require more air conditioning than others, aiding you minimize energy costs by only cooling the necessary areas. Assessing these facets of your home's layout will assist you towards picking the most ideal air conditioning system for your particular requirements.
